Postgres 可以替代 Redis 作为缓存吗?
因此,Stephan甚至更进一步建议我们使用ChatGPT来编写存储过程。CREATEORREPLACEPROCEDUREexpire_rows(retention_periodINTERVAL)AS$$BEGINDELETEFROMcacheWHEREinserted_at<NOW()-retention_period;COMMIT;END;$$LANGUAGEplpgsql;CALLexpire_rows('60minutes');--Thiswillremoverowsolderthan1...
微软提高 OneNote 安全防护,禁止运行.bat 等 120 种文件类型
微软OneNote此前打开.bat等文件类型的时候,会跳出警告对话框,告知用户打开该附件可能会损害其数据。不过用户依然可以选择打开标记为危险的嵌入式文件。在安全改进推出后,用户将无法再选择打开具有危险扩展名的文件。微软会跳出一个,告知用户:“你的管理员已阻止您在OneNote中打开此文件类型”。微软表示,该更...
SQL Server存储过程编写经验和优化措施
iii.在新建临时表时,如果一次性插入数据量很大,那么可以使用selectinto代替createtable,避免log,提高速度;如果数据量不大,为了缓和系统表的资源,建议先createtable,然后insert。iv.如果临时表的数据量较大,需要建立索引,那么应该将创建临时表和建立索引的过程放在单独一个子存储过程中,这样才能保证系统能够很好的使...
技术分享文档-oracle10g重建XDB(XDB 是关于高性能处理XML 数据)
c、确保存储XDB信息的表空间有只是350M以上的空闲空间,以下存储过程可以鉴定:d、确保SHARED_POOL_SIZE和JAVA_POOL_SIZE参数值在250M以上。接下来就是正式重建过程:首先执行catnoqm.sql脚本RemovalXDB然而,在执行以上脚本过程中,sys用户里面一些与XDB相关的对象不会被删除,比如SYS.KU$_%视图会被置成失效状...
被吹得天花乱坠的无服务器架构,究竟是什么?
系统管理的工作仍然要做,你只是把它外包给了Serverless环境。这既不能说坏也不能说好——我们外包了大量的内容,是好是坏要看具体情况。不论怎样,某些时候这层抽象也会发生问题,就会需要一个来自某个地方的人类系统管理员来支持你的工作了。对比存储过程即服务...
到2020年,智能手机将拥有十项AI功能,有些可能会出乎你意料
在Gartner看来,由于数据的处理和存储过程是在本地进行,因而人工智能设备的普及意味着数据安全性和电池性能的提升(www.e993.com)2024年11月17日。在2020年,搭载以下10种AI功能的智能手机将走入我们的生活。而这些新功能在带给人们期待的同时,也不可避免地引发人们的担忧。1)用户行为预测...
搭建Spark所遇过的坑
编译spark,hiveonspark就不要加-Phive参数,若需sparkSQL支持hive语法则要加-Phive参数通过hive源文件pom.xml查看适配的spark版本,只要打版本保持一致就行,例如spark1.6.0和1.6.2都能匹配打开Hive命令行客户端,观察输出日志是否有打印“SLF4J:Foundbindingin[jar:file:/work/poa/hive-2.1.0-bin/lib/spar...